Highest Education Level

Administrators in Southbury, CT offer the following education background
Master's Degree
45.6%
Bachelor's Degree
36.8%
Doctorate Degree
6.1%
Associate's Degree
5.2%
High School or GED
3.0%
Vocational Degree or Certification
2.6%
Some College
0.6%
Some High School
0.1%
